Reading and West Berkshire areas where Covid cases are rising

Pic: Gov.uk A total of 10 areas in Reading and West Berkshire have seen an increase in Coronavirus cases. The data, which is taken from the seven days ending April 29, shows the total number of cases and a comparison on the week before. It also reveals the rolling rate, which are calculated by dividing the seven day count by the area population and multiplying by 100,000. In areas with with fewer than three cases data is not revealed in order to protect individuals' identities.

Van Dealer Of The Year, 66, accidentally mowed down contractor 'in moment of madness'

The director of an award-winning car company ploughed into a contractor in a 'moment of madness' following an argument, a judge has heard. Graham Joyce, 66, from Cold Ash, Thatcham, Berkshire, who won 'Van Dealer of the Year' for two consecutive years, drove into Colin Green as the contractor prepared to unload his van on January 31 last year. Drivers fined for breaching vehicle weight restrictions in Berkshire

Case 2 Some of the roads in and around Streatley, Berkshire, are subject to an 18 tonne weight restriction to protect the road and local residents. On July 28, 2020, a Trading Standards Traffic Enforcement Officer observed a Volvo heavy goods vehicle (HGV), travel through the weight restriction on the A329 Wallingford Road, Streatley. The vehicle had a maximum gross weight of 32 tons. At a hearing on the April 9, 2021, the driver pleaded guilty by post and the court fined him £125 and ordered him to pay £175 contribution towards costs and £34 Victim’s Surcharge.
